Consumer:Using erythromycin together with cimetidine may increase the effects of erythromycin. Contact your doctor if you experience n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, stomach pain, or hearing loss. If your doctor does prescribe these medications together, you may need a dose adjustment or special test to safely use both medications. Professional:MONITOR: Concomitant use of cimetidine and erythromycin may result in higher-than-normal plasma levels of erythromycin through inhibition of CYP450 metabolism by cimetidine. One small study has reported an increase of 73% in the area under the plasma concentration-time curve. Bilateral hearing loss occurred in one patient who had renal dysfunction and was receiving a high dose of erythromycin. This interaction may occur with other macrolide antibiotics.
MANAGEMENT: The patient should be monitored for evidence of adverse effects such as n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, or abdominal pain. Ranitidine, nizatidine and famotidine do not inhibit CYP450 and would not be expected to affect erythromycin levels at recommended doses.
